APAC's military modernization leverages AI, robotics, IoMT, cyber defense, 5G, and more for enhanced regional security and stability.
FREMONT, CA: Military modernization is sweeping the Asia-Pacific region as nations leverage advanced technologies. This surge is driven by the pursuit of national security, optimized operations, and a strategic advantage in a rapidly shifting geopolitical landscape. From artificial intelligence to robotics, these advancements promise a future of enhanced defense capabilities in the APAC region.
Key Technological Advancements Shaping The Future Of APAC Defense:

Artificial Intelligence (AI): AI revolutionizes military planning, logistics, and combat operations. AI algorithms can analyze vast amounts of data to predict enemy movements, optimize resource allocation, and guide autonomous weapons systems.
Advanced Defense Equipment: From next-generation fighter jets with enhanced stealth capabilities to directed-energy weapons, advancements in defense equipment are transforming battlefield dynamics. These systems offer greater firepower, improved precision, and superior situational awareness for APAC militaries.
Robotics And Autonomous Systems (RAS): Unmanned aerial vehicles (UAVs), also known as drones, are already commonplace, and their capabilities are evolving. Ground-based robots are finding roles in reconnaissance, explosive ordnance disposal (EOD), and logistics, minimizing human risk.
Internet of Military Things (IoMT): Connecting military equipment and personnel through a secure network allows real-time data sharing, improved coordination, and enhanced decision-making. IoMT fosters a more responsive and agile force structure.
Cyber Warfare: As reliance on digital infrastructure grows, so does the threat of cyberattacks. APAC nations invest in robust cyber defenses to safeguard critical military systems and infrastructure from disruption or manipulation.
Immersive Technologies: Virtual reality (VR) and augmented reality (AR) are finding applications in military training, simulation exercises, and medical applications. VR/AR allows for realistic and immersive training scenarios, improving soldier preparedness.
Additive Manufacturing (3D Printing): 3D printing allows for the on-demand production of complex military parts and equipment, reducing logistical challenges and shortening supply chains. This fosters greater operational flexibility and self-sufficiency for APAC forces.
Big Data & Analytics: The ability to collect, analyze, and interpret vast amounts of data is crucial for modern militaries. Big data analytics empowers commanders to identify patterns, make informed decisions, and predict enemy actions.
5G Connectivity: The next generation of wireless communication offers unparalleled speed and bandwidth, enabling seamless data transfer between soldiers, equipment, and command centers. This fosters real-time battlefield awareness and facilitates collaborative operations.
Blockchain: Blockchain technology offers a secure and tamper-proof way to manage sensitive military data, such as logistics records and supply chain information. This fosters transparency, accountability, and improved efficiency within APAC defense establishments.
These advancements are not happening in isolation. They are converging to create a more interconnected and intelligent battlefield. AI-powered autonomous systems, for instance, can leverage real-time data from IoMT sensors and be guided by advanced analytics. This integrated approach promises significant improvements in military effectiveness.
The focus on technological advancements within APAC defense reflects a commitment to regional security and stability. By harnessing the power of innovation, APAC nations are ensuring their militaries are well-equipped to address the evolving security landscape and safeguard national interests.
